Some examples of small payments made from petty cash include: Paying the mail carrier 30 cents for the postage due on a letter. Reimbursing an employee $9 for supplies purchased. Reimbursing an employee for purchasing $14 of bakery goods for an early morning meeting.

The custodian of petty cash should sign the receipt to indicate that he authorized the funds. However, you should also have the recipient sign the receipt. This makes it easier to follow the paper trail if there is a dispute about the amount dispensed from petty cash or the purpose for which it was used.

The form is filled out by the petty cash custodian, documenting the reason for a petty cash payment and the amount of the payment, as well as the date. At a minimum, it is signed by the custodian, and preferably also by the cash recipient.

The name of the payer. The amount of cash received. The payment method (such as by cash or check) The signature of the receiving person.

Given the uses just noted for the petty cash voucher, the information on it should contain the amount of cash taken, the date on which the cash was taken, the name of the person who took the cash, the initials of the person dispensing the cash, and the type of expense to be charged.

The voucher information may come from the petty cash book. An accounting staff person reviews and approves the form and sends a copy to the accounts payable staff, along with all vouchers referenced on the form.

The petty cash journal entry is a debit to the petty cash account and a credit to the cash account. The petty cash custodian refills the petty cash drawer or box, which should now contain the original amount of cash that was designated for the fund. The cashier creates a journal entry to record the petty cash receipts.
